which some are calling the “armed branch of the Muslim Brotherhood terrorist organization,” that runs the coastal enclave.

A major Egyptian television news commentator savaged Hamas on Sunday for its support of the Muslim Brotherhood, and called on her country to join Israel and strike the Islamist group.

“The Egyptian people know exactly who they are facing, and understand that there is no alternative to employing the Egyptian army to strike terror cells in Gaza and destroy Hamas in a military operation,” Hayah Al Dardiri, a presenter for Egypt Today told viewers.

Another pundit, Azza Sami, of the newspaper Al-Ahram wrote, “Thank you (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in) Netanyahu and may God give us more [people] like you to destroy Hamas.”

And the critique of Hamas wasn’t only in the media.
